Arrowhawk is a beautifully illustrated story about a hawk’s survival after being shot with an arrow by a poacher.   This is a story based on a teacher’s experience following the tail of an injured hawk with her fourth-grade students. A hawk, properly named Arrowhawk, was shot through his thigh and tail.  This is his story of an eight week journey south and the obstacles that he faced.  Swiatkoska’s illustrations help the reader visualize what Arrowhawk went through.  She uses acrylic on cold-pressed paper to create these breathtaking illustrations. (Trade Book)
